A member asked:

Will pneumocystis infection kill me?

2 doctors weighed in across 2 answers

It can: It is unfortunate that by the time you get pneumocystis your immune system is severely compromised. It is a treatable condition with good but not excellent survival chances. Treatment should continue until your immune system builds back up again.
